This doesn't look like havoc, just the Mac running properly. https://support.apple.com/en-gb/HT207359 says that Kernel task appears to use CPU and is doing it to avoid overheating your Mac. Adobe's apps work hard, so this is a normal response. All working as designed, right? You say there is an issue, but what is the issue??
